### The Foundation of Christianity
Christianity is a monotheistic religion based on the life and teachings of Jesus Christ. It is one of the world's largest religions, with over 2.3 billion followers worldwide. The foundational principles of Christianity include:
- - Belief in God as the creator of the universe
- Jesus Christ as the Son of God and the savior of humanity
- The Holy Spirit as the source of divine guidance
### The Life and Teachings of Jesus Christ
Jesus Christ, the central figure of Christianity, lived in the first century CE in Israel. According to the Gospels, he was a teacher, healer, and miracle worker who preached a message of love, forgiveness, and the kingdom of God.
Jesus' teachings emphasized the importance of
- - Love for God and neighbor
- Humility and compassion
- Repentance and salvation
- Prayer and faith
### The Holy Bible
The Holy Bible is the sacred text of Christianity, containing the inspired writings of various authors. It consists of two main sections:
- - **Old Testament:** Includes historical accounts, prophecies, poetry, and wisdom literature from the period before Jesus Christ
- **New Testament:** Records the life, death, and resurrection of Jesus Christ, as well as the teachings of his apostles
### Christian Beliefs and Practices
Christians hold various beliefs and practices that shape their faith
**Beliefs:**
- - Trinity: God is one God in three persons (Father, Son, and Holy Spirit)
- Incarnation: Jesus Christ is fully human and fully divine
- Resurrection: Jesus rose from the dead, conquering sin and death
- Salvation: Belief in Jesus Christ grants eternal life
**Practices:**
- - Worship: Christians gather for worship services to praise God, pray, and listen to sermons
- Baptism: A sacrament representing cleansing from sin and initiation into the Christian community
- Communion: A sacrament where believers partake in bread and wine, symbolizing Jesus' body and blood
- Prayer: A vital practice of communicating with God
- Mission: Christians are called to share their faith and serve others
